A woman from Somerset West has received a ten-year prison sentence for defrauding an elderly couple of over R94,000. The 38-year-old exploited the couple’s trust through deceptive banking schemes. The court found her guilty of financial exploitation, highlighting the vulnerability of elderly individuals to fraud. The sentencing aims to deter similar crimes and protect senior citizens from financial abuse. Authorities have not released details regarding the specifics of the banking practices used in the fraud.
